使用jQuery实现点击弹出登录窗口功能
下载需积分: 6 | RAR格式 | 23KB |
更新于2025-01-06
| 167 浏览量 | 举报
资源摘要信息: "jquery点击弹出登录窗口"
本资源介绍的是如何使用jQuery库来实现一个点击事件触发弹出登录窗口的功能。jQuery是一个快速、小巧、功能丰富的JavaScript库,通过简化HTML文档遍历、事件处理、动画和Ajax交互等操作,使得Web开发变得更加简便快捷。
知识点1: jQuery基础
jQuery通过简洁的API,使得开发者能够轻松地选择DOM元素、绑定事件处理器、实现动画效果和进行Ajax交互。它提供的核心功能包括元素选择器、CSS操作、属性操作、事件处理等。
知识点2: 点击事件处理
点击事件是用户交互中最常见的一种形式。在jQuery中,可以使用`.click()`方法为选定的元素绑定点击事件处理器。例如,`$('element').click(function(){ ... });`这段代码表示为id为"element"的DOM元素绑定一个点击事件,点击时执行其中的函数。
知识点3: 弹出窗口实现
弹出窗口通常指的是在网页上通过JavaScript动态创建的对话框或覆盖层。在jQuery中,可以使用`.dialog()`方法或者手动创建HTML元素,并通过`.show()`方法使其可见来实现弹出窗口的效果。
知识点4: 登录窗口设计
登录窗口一般包括用户名和密码输入框以及登录和取消按钮。在HTML中,可以使用`<form>`标签来布局这些组件。为了增强用户体验和安全性,还需要在前端进行输入验证,并且可能需要使用JavaScript和后端技术来处理用户提交的登录信息。
知识点5: Ajax技术
在实现登录功能时,通常需要将用户输入的数据发送到服务器进行验证。Ajax(Asynchronous JavaScript and XML)允许页面在不重新加载的情况下与服务器交换数据并更新部分页面内容。使用jQuery的`$.ajax()`方法,可以非常方便地实现与服务器的异步通信。
知识点6: 安全性考量
在处理登录功能时,安全性是一个重要的考虑因素。开发者需要确保传输过程中敏感信息(如密码)加密处理,并且服务器端进行严格的数据验证,防止诸如SQL注入等安全漏洞。
知识点7: jQuery文档和资源
对于学习和深入理解jQuery,jQuery官方文档是最权威的参考资料。此外,网络上有大量的教程、插件和示例代码可以帮助开发者快速掌握jQuery的使用方法和最佳实践。
知识点8: 其他相关技术
在实现复杂的用户交互和动态效果时,可能还会涉及到其他技术,如CSS3动画、前端框架(如React、Vue.js)、后端技术(如Node.js、PHP、Python等)以及数据库技术(如MySQL、MongoDB等)。
总结而言,"jquery点击弹出登录窗口"资源的掌握涉及到从基础的jQuery操作到实际应用中用户交互的实现,再到前后端数据交互的细节处理,以及最后的安全性考量。这不仅考验了开发者的JavaScript和jQuery技能,还包括了前端开发的综合能力和对Web安全的理解。通过学习和实践这些知识点,开发者可以提升自己在前端开发领域的专业水平。
相关推荐
拥抱开源
- 粉丝: 203
- 资源: 1291
最新资源
- 设置Windows 10 1903/1909/2004的脚本-.NET开发
- 一个TCP和UPD聊天、传收文件程序
- Homework-QUestion
- MTK10.0竖屏壁纸居中补丁.zip
- xiubox
- 键盘测试工具,机械键盘换轴后检测用
- echidna:W3C的新发布工作流程-主要组件
- Vue Devtools
- SoapUI(附安装步骤).rar
- pid控制器代码matlab-CDC18a:A.Selivanov和E.Fridman,“PID控制器的鲁棒采样数据实现”,在第57届IEEE
- animeWiki
- mcjoin:简单的多播测试应用程序
- abc:aa
- Asc2Silo file converter-开源
- 行业文档-设计装置-一种拱桥施工平台结构.zip
- BE2Works_v4.52_Bohol_fu11.7z